The Pakistan Meteorological Department (PMD) has predicted rain, wind, and thunderstorms in several areas of Khyber Pakhtunkhwa KP. Some hilly regions may also experience snowfall. The affected areas include Chitral, Dir, Swat, Kohistan, Shangla, Battagram, Mansehra, Abbottabad, Nowshera, Swabi, Mardan, Buner, Peshawar, Kohat, Karak, Bannu, Bajaur, Mohmand, Kurram, Khyber, and Waziristan.   ABBOTTABAD: Snowfall continues for the third consecutive day in Mansehra, Kaghan Valley, Naran, Shogran and Babusar Top of Hazara division bringing the region mercury below the minus. Intermittent rains also continue in Mansehra plains areas, Saran Valley, Konish Valley, Ogi, and Tanal. Mansehra-Kaghan highway landslides were reported at several places.
